Unexpected

Choi Minho is a very famous model who, expectedly, is very good looking.

He’s a very serious man who smells like coffee almost all the time, lives alone and likes quiet places, which is why he lives in a small apartment even though he’s famous and rich and could afford a huge villa; he prefered cozy, calm places over big, empty ones. Also, the people who live in his building are mostly elderly people who don’t even know him.

 

Minho groans loudly when he hears loud noises outside; it was almost eleven in the morning, he was drinking his coffee and using his computer.

He walks to the door and opens it to find several boxed piled up and the door of the apartment across of his wide open. Someone was moving.

He shrugged and turned to close the door and go back inside, he had nothing to do with this anyway.

“Oh hello!” a voice called.

Minho turned  back around to find a boy with golden blonde hair standing by the doorway of the other apartment, he looked young, Minho assumed he was in his early twenties and-

“Wait,” the boy squinted his eyes and tilted his head as he walked towards Minho, “you’re Choi Minho, aren’t you?”

Oh great.

“I am-”

“Oh my, you’re even more handsome in real life”! the boy exclaimed.

Minho gave him a tiny, awkward smile before making a move to go back inside.

“I’m Lee Taemin, by the way.”

“I didn’t ask.”

“I can’t believe that the one and only Choi Minho is living just next door.” Taemin carried on like he heard nothing.

“I shall invite you to lunch someday,” Taemin suggested, “what food do you like?”

The boy is already talking too much. How Minho is going to live with this from today and on?

“Anyway, um….could you help me moving those boxes in please? They’re heavy-”

“Alright.” Minho interrupted, he’d do anything to get this kid to shut up.


 

Several days later, Minho heard someone knocking on his door, without even opening the door, he knew who was there.

“Hey Minho.” Taemin spoke as soon as he opened the door. Minho fought the urge to roll his eyes.

“Hey remember the lunch I told you about?” Taemin asked.

Minho wanted to say no, the boy talked about too many stuff the past few days and he couldn’t remember any of them.

“Well, I thought that maybe tomorrow you could come over.”

“Can’t,” Minho spoke for the first time, “I have a shoot tomorrow.” and shoots take hours.

“Oh.” was all that Taemin replied with, he looked genuinely disappointed. Minho felt guilty.

“How-how about Sunday?” Minho suggested.

Taemin’s face lit up as he smiled widely, “Great!”


 

Forty-eight hours later.

Minho walked in the blonde boy’s apartment; the walls were bright green, unlike his that were light blue, the place was somewhat crowded and messy, it was filled with furniture and many unnecessary stuff, it was too colorful-awfully colorful which explains a lot. It matches Taemin perfectly; very loud, very lively, very annoying.

They ate the dinner that Taemin cooked for them and talked-well Taemin actually talked while Minho tried not to fall asleep.

He regretted his suggestion of having a meal with the blonde boy.

Seriously, what was he thinking.

“What do you think, Minho?” Taemin’s voice slapped back to reality.

“Oh, good, I guess.” he answered cluelessly. He lost track of what Taemin was talking about.

“Good? You think it’s good that a customer was being rude to me because I’m gay?”

“What-weren’t you talking about painting your kitchen walls?”

“That was an hour ago.”


 

It’s been almost a month since Taemin moved in. Minho started getting used to the boy, he got closer to him (not by choice) and learned so many things about the boy. Even though he didn’t want to.

The boy is 21 years old-2 years younger than Minho, and is in arts college. He also works at a coffee shop and somewhere else, Minho can’t remember, to support himself.

And, if anything, the boy got more loquacious as the time passed which Minho wasn’t pleased about. He really missed peaceful mornings and quiet afternoons without having Taemin knocking on his door or blasting music in his apartment for an hour or so.

Right, he was a person who liked calmness over loudness and quiet over talkative yet he couldn’t deny that spending time with the blonde boy was something he secretly enjoyed. He talked too much, that’s right but Minho grew to like having someone babble about nonsense to him almost all the time.

He discovered that when Taemin informed that he’d be leaving for a week to visit his parents.

Minho felt lonely that week, even though he was surrounded by people all the time. He felt as if something was messing, something was not right.

He slept less during that week, always finding it hard to fall asleep, feeling like something was left undone.

Even if he daren’t admit it, he missed the boy.

He missed having Taemin knock on his door almost every single morning, asking about meaningless stuff just as an excuse to annoy him.

He missed getting stuck in the elevator with Taemin, even if it was for a few seconds before they both could leave to their destinations. Taemin always managed to vex him even if he only had few seconds to do so.

He missed having Taemin ask him for help.

He simply missed having the golden boy around. He made his days brighter, he made him feel more alive.

It is Friday, Taemin is supposed to come back home today. Unfortunately, Minho had to go to work.

“Thank you everybody.” he bowed respectfully to everyone when they took the last shot of him, finally freeing him.

Minho didn’t even bother change his clothes, he walked to the changing room, stuffed his things in his bag and hurried out.

He wasn’t sure why he was this excited to meet the boy, but he was.

Minho drove his car home, and when he got to the seventh floor he simply stared at Taemin’s door.

He stayed in his spot for a while, not knowing how long he was standing there for, or why he was standing there.

The door of Taemin’s apartment suddenly opened, revealing a Taemin with two garbage bags.

Both boys looked at each other in shock, clearly not expecting to see each other.

Minho’s face reddened a little, embarrassed that he was busted standing outside the boy’s flat like this.

“Hi Minho!” the boy greeted. He was smiling very widely. Minho liked his smile more than he could ever admit.

“Hi Tae.” he replied with a low voice.

“What are you doing here?” the blonde asked.

“I-I just got-I just came from work.” Choi Minho never stutters like an idiot.

“I see, well I also got home today,” Taemin said, “you know from my parent’s-”

“Yes, yes.” the older boy interrupted.

“By the way you look very handsome in that suit.” the blonde blurted out. Looking at the model dreamily, no traces of embarrassment on his face.

Minho always wondered where did he get all of that confidence from.

“Than-”

“I had so much fun at my parent’s, I missed you but I had a very good time. You know my brother, who’s actually younger than my got his driving license while I, the older one, haven’t got mine yet. Also, my mom invited all of our relatives when I got there and they made me sing for them, they liked it a lot and they said I’m very talented, I should perform to you once so you can tell me what do you think, yes?” Taemin spoke all at once, “I also told them about you, they said I’m very lucky to have a hot neighbor, I agree though.” the boy added shamelessly.

Minho looked at him with his huge eyes, trying to take in everything the boy just said.

“Oh and Minho I brought you some delicious snacks, and my mom sent you a slice of her apple pie, you have no idea how good-”

Minho walked to him, ignoring everything he was saying, cupped his face and smashed their lips together.

The model felt thousands of fireworks explode in head, it felt too good, too wonderful and sinfully amazing. Taemin’s lip were pillowy, plump and soft.

The younger boy gasped, obviously not expecting this to happen but started kissing him back seconds later, wrapping his arms loosely around Minho’s neck.

Minutes later, they pulled away, both panting heavily as their eyes locked together.

They simply looked at each other, taking in each other’s features.

“Oh and Minho-”

Shut up.
